As a digital artist, your goal isn't just to create visually appealing websites; it's to craft experiences that prompt conversions. To achieve this, you need to grasp the psychology behind more info user behavior and apply design strategies that guide visitors toward taking targeted actions.
- Prioritize on clarity and simplicity in your website's layout. Make it simple for users to find what they're looking for.
- Leverage strong call-to-actions (CTAs) that are clear and enticing.
- Improve your website's loading speed to reduce bounce rates. A slow site can deter visitors.
By incorporating these strategies, you can create a high-converting website that reaches its targets. Remember, the key is to put the user experience at the priority.

Building Websites that Adjust to Any Device
In today's digital landscape, where users browse content across a vast range of devices, responsive design has become an essential element for website visibility. Responsive design is a methodology that ensures websites display flawlessly on all screen dimensions, from tiny mobile phones to extensive desktops. By utilizing adaptive layouts and media inquiries, developers can create websites that smoothly rearrange to accommodate the particular requirements of each platform.
- Merits of responsive design include boosted user experience, increased engagement, and enhanced website efficiency.
- By adopting responsive design principles, websites can serve a wider user base, leading to greater awareness and prosperity.

Unlocking Accessibility: Designing Inclusive Websites for Everyone
Building accessible websites is not just a moral imperative, but also a strategic advantage. By considering the needs of all users, including those with disabilities, we can create engaging experiences that reach a wider audience. A truly comprehensive web experience starts with understanding the principles of accessibility and implementing effective design solutions. This means providing clear layout, alternative text for images, and keyboard-accessible content, among other crucial considerations. By embracing these guidelines, we can ensure that everyone, regardless of their abilities, can access and enjoy the wealth of information and opportunities available online.
Some key aspects to consider include:
- Offering clear and concise language
- Ensuring proper color contrast for readability
- Using descriptive link text
- Designing keyboard-navigable interfaces
By prioritizing in accessibility, we create a more equitable web for all. It's a win-win situation that benefits both users and website owners.
